Boycott Is Over!


Dear Editor:

The boycott is over, and patrons of the state cafeterias in the St. Paul Capitol complex can once again eat at establishments that support fair labor practices. Last week, an agreement was reached between Taher, Unite Here 17, and the Teamsters to ensure that food workers will receive health benefits and have their interests represented by the Teamsters. Former, long-time state cafeteria workers will be offered the opportunity to continue working. Clearly our boycott worked! I want to thank all fellow boycotters for their determination to continue the boycott in session if needed – happily there is no longer any need.
